First Trust Asia Pacific Ex-Japan AlphaDEX Fund seeks results that correspond generally to the price and yield (before the fund's fees and expenses) of an equity index called the NASDAQ AlphaDEX Asia Pacific Ex-Japan Index. The fund will normally invest at least 90% of its net assets (including investment borrowings) in the securities that comprise the index. The index is designed to select stocks from the NASDAQ Asia Pacific Ex-Japan Index that may generate positive alpha, or risk-adjusted returns, relative to traditional indices through the use of the AlphaDEX selection methodology.
